plc如何通过通讯控制服务器

fiy 其他 58

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    PLC(可编程逻辑控制器)是一种常用的工业自动化设备,用于控制和监控生产过程。通信控制服务器是一个具有通信功能的服务器,PLC可以通过与通信控制服务器进行通信来实现远程控制和监控。下面将详细介绍PLC如何通过通讯控制服务器进行控制。

    首先,PLC需要与通讯控制服务器建立连接。通常情况下,PLC与服务器之间通过以太网进行通信。PLC连接到以太网交换机,而服务器也连接到同一个交换机,通过IP地址进行通信。PLC需要配置其网络设置,包括IP地址、子网掩码、网关等参数,以确保能够与服务器正常通信。

    其次,PLC需要使用适当的通信协议与服务器进行通信。常用的通信协议包括Modbus、OPC等。根据具体的服务器和通信需求,PLC需要选择相应的通信协议,并进行相应的配置。通信协议定义了PLC如何与服务器进行数据交换和控制命令的传输。

    接下来,PLC需要编写相应的程序来与服务器进行通信。这涉及到使用PLC的编程软件进行PLC程序的开发。通过编写适当的逻辑和指令,PLC可以读取服务器发送的数据,并根据需要发送控制命令给服务器。这些程序可以包括数据读取、数据写入、报警处理等功能。编写PLC程序需要具备相关的编程知识和经验。

    最后,PLC通过与通讯控制服务器进行通信,实现远程控制和监控。通过读取服务器发送的数据,PLC可以获取生产过程中的各种参数和状态,如温度、压力、速度等。根据这些数据,PLC可以进行相应的控制策略,如开关设备、调整参数等。同时,PLC还可以将自身的状态和数据发送给服务器,以进行远程的监控和故障排除。

    综上所述,PLC可以通过与通讯控制服务器进行通信,实现远程控制和监控。通过建立连接、选择通信协议、编写程序等步骤,PLC可以与服务器实现数据交换和控制命令的传输,从而实现对生产过程的控制。这为工业自动化提供了更加灵活和便利的控制方式。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PLC(可编程逻辑控制器)是一种用于自动化控制系统的特殊计算机设备。它可以通过与其他设备进行通信来实现对服务器的控制。以下是PLC通过通信控制服务器的几种常见方法:

    1. Modbus通信:Modbus是一种通信协议,用于在PLC与其他设备之间进行数据传输。PLC可以通过Modbus协议与服务器进行通信,实现对服务器的控制。PLC作为Modbus的主站,可以通过读取和写入数据寄存器的方式来获取和修改服务器的数据。

    2. OPC通信:OPC(OLE for Process Control)是一种用于在自动化领域中实现设备之间数据交换的标准。PLC和服务器可以通过OPC通信协议进行数据传输。PLC作为OPC客户端,可以通过读取和写入OPC服务器上的变量来控制服务器的操作。

    3. TCP/IP通信:PLC可以通过TCP/IP协议与服务器进行通信。PLC可以使用网络模块或以太网口将自身与服务器连接在同一个网络中。通过使用标准的网络通信协议,PLC可以向服务器发送控制命令,并接收服务器的响应。

    4. Web服务通信:有些服务器提供Web服务接口,允许通过HTTP协议进行通信。PLC可以通过发送HTTP请求来控制服务器。可以通过使用PLC的网络模块或以太网口来实现与服务器的通信。

    5. RESTful API通信:RESTful是一种基于HTTP协议的Web服务架构。如果服务器提供了RESTful API接口,PLC可以使用HTTP请求来与服务器进行通信。通过向服务器发送RESTful API请求,PLC可以对服务器进行控制和监控。

    通过这些通信方式,PLC可以与服务器进行数据交换和控制操作。PLC可以获取服务器上的数据,并根据需要修改和操作这些数据,从而实现对服务器的远程监控和控制。这种通信方式使得PLC在自动化系统中起到重要的作用,提高了系统的可靠性和灵活性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PLC(可编程逻辑控制器)是一种用于自动化控制系统的专用计算机控制设备,可以用来控制和监测机器或过程的运行。通过与其他设备进行通信,PLC可以实现与服务器的通信,以实现更高级的控制和监测功能。

    下面是将PLC通过通信控制服务器的一般方法和操作流程的详细说明:

    1. 准备工作
      在开始PLC与服务器之间的通信之前,您需要进行一些准备工作:
    • 了解服务器的通信协议和通信接口:通信协议和接口可能会根据服务器品牌和型号的不同而有所不同。确保您了解服务器所使用的通信协议和接口,以便正确配置PLC。
    • 确定PLC和服务器之间的通信类型:通信可以使用不同的类型,如以太网、串行通信等。根据您的需求和硬件设备的支持,选择适合的通信类型。
    1. 配置PLC
      PLC需要通过其编程软件进行配置,以设置与服务器的通信参数。具体的步骤可能因PLC品牌和型号的不同而有所不同,但基本流程如下:
      -打开PLC编程软件并连接到PLC。
      -创建一个新项目或打开现有项目。
      -配置通信参数:在项目设置或通信设置中,设置与服务器的通信参数,包括通信协议、通信接口、IP地址、端口号等。

    2. 连接PLC和服务器
      PLC和服务器之间的连接取决于所选择的通信类型。以下是几种常见的连接方式:

    • 以太网连接:如果PLC和服务器都支持以太网通信,您可以直接通过以太网连接它们。确保PLC和服务器在同一网络中,并配置适当的IP地址和子网掩码。
    • 串行连接:如果PLC和服务器之间使用串行通信,您需要使用适当的串行通信线缆将它们连接起来。确保设置正确的通信协议、波特率等参数。
    1. 编写PLC程序
      一旦PLC和服务器成功连接,您可以开始编写PLC程序以实现与服务器的通信。根据通信协议和服务器的要求,您可能需要使用特定的指令或函数块来发送和接收数据。具体的编程方法可以参考PLC编程软件的文档或使用手册。

    2. 测试和调试
      完成PLC程序后,您可以进行测试和调试以确保通信正常工作。以下是一些测试和调试的建议:
      -检查PLC和服务器之间的物理连接是否正确。
      -确保PLC程序中的通信参数与服务器的设置相匹配。
      -发送和接收一些简单的测试数据,以验证通信是否成功。
      -跟踪和记录通信错误和异常,以便进行故障排除。

    3. 部署和监测
      一旦PLC与服务器之间的通信成功建立,您可以将PLC部署到实际的应用场景中。定期监测PLC和服务器之间的通信状态,并及时处理任何通信问题。

    总结:
    通过以上步骤,您可以将PLC通过通信与服务器进行控制。请确保在进行任何配置和编程操作之前,详细了解使用的PLC和服务器的规格和要求,并遵循相关的安装和操作说明。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部